IIUI’S NANO-PHOTO CATALYSIS LABORATORY TEAM EARNS ACCOLADES FOR RESEARCH

Associate Prof, Department of Physics, Dr. Shamaila Sajjad and her team at National Research Programme for Universities (NRPU) funded Nano-photo Catalysis Laboratory of International Islamic University (IIU) have conducted various projects (for year 2019-20) on water splitting and photocatalysis.

The research output is published in world highly ranked SCI journals, Journal of Hazardous Material (Impact Factor of 9.03), Journal of Cleaner Production (Impact Factor of 7.249) and International Journal of Hydrogen Energy (Impact Factor of 5.0). In addition to these, Dr Shamaila Sajjad and research students completed and published 16 projects on nanocomposite materials focusing on electrochemical reactions for energy applications and environmental remediation. The collective impact factor achieved from these projects for this year is 55-60. The Nano-photo Catalysis Laboratory is established by Dr. Shamaila Sajjad by 11.7 M HEC funded NRPU project.
